So, what exactly is a doula? A doula is a trained professional with a heartfelt commitment to guiding and offering continuous physical, emotional, and informational support to you and your family before, during, and shortly after childbirth. We wear many hats in this role, which includes advocating for your needs, empowering you to fulfill your specific birthing desires, safeguarding your birth plan, and standing by you with unwavering support if unforeseen changes occur. Throughout labor and delivery, we provide personalized assistance, employing comfort measures and pain relief techniques such as breathing, relaxation, massage, and optimal laboring positions. We also work closely with your partner, reassuring them and guiding them in how they can best comfort and support you.
Embracing the Benefits Extensive research has illuminated the remarkable advantages of enlisting a doula's services, resulting in improved birth outcomes. Expectant mothers who choose a doula's support are two times less likely to encounter complications during childbirth, both for themselves and their baby. Furthermore, the information and encouragement provided by a doula during pregnancy have been shown to enhance a mother's self-confidence and her capacity to influence her own pregnancy and birth outcomes.
